Accordion Noir radio playlist 2023-02-08: February in Training for February?

Our alt-accordion radio program’s host Bruce is once again going to be abroad on the night of our weekly broadcast, so he has pre-recorded this episode to air this Wednesday night. (You online listeners can get the drop on the ones limited to only experiencing our program over the radio.) If I am interpreting his episode title correctly (always more of a dark art than a science, but I do have lots of practice at it) he will be travelling by rail, but unlike previous trips taken via that transportation mode, I do not believe that they set the theme for the episode. Indeed, eyeballing the playlist, I am not convinced that the episode has a theme per se, beyond that of our standard melange of different styles of squeezebox music from different cultures all around the planet! Fortunately for us, it’s a mix that seems to work.
